Automatic Hardness Testing on crankshafts
This hardness test bench for crankshafts is a especially for this case constructed machine using a Rockwell- testing head. Clamping and unclamping as well as the positioning of the test piece are manually operated. The positioning as well as the clamping of the test gripper (with hardness test head) happens motorised due to operating the corresponding controls and sensors.
All controls for setting up the machine and for the electronic positioning and test gripper clamping are placed in an operator panel in front of the machine. Through a serial interface at the hardness test head, measured values can easily be sent to a data capture device (printer, pc).
The crankshaft will be transported to the hardness test bench using a suitable hoist (hoist and separate lifting accessories are not included in delivery) and will be placed and clamped between spikes.
To realise this, the clamp table has to be driven to its open cut load position.
The crankshaft can be rotated to its axis and manual freely positioned m below the test head. If the machine has reached its testing position, the user is operating the electromechanic / -pneumatic bracing and centering.
The hardness test head is electromotive movable in Z-axis.
The hardness measurement can be made by manual or electromotive testing.
For security reasons, all electromechanic / -pneumatic movements are only in two-hand operating available!

The hardness tester for rims is an electromechanic special hardness tester, that is specialised for rim testing. The test frame divides in samples table, guidance device with load device followed from the test head.
The actuation of the guidance device results from a AC- servomotor over an elevating screw . With this actuation the test force (minor load) will be applied to the test piece.
The applying of total test force happens through a pneumatic bellows cylinder. For manual positioning of test pieces on the samples table, two laserpointer are fitted on the device penetrator.

Hardness tester for bulky parts
The hardness testing equipment consists of a ball roll table and a motorized height adjustable Rockwell hardness tester (Ernst AT-130).
Bulky or heavy workpieces can be put down by means of lifting apparatus on the ball roll table and be pushed manually into the necessary test position.
The height of the construction units does not play a role by the motor adjustableness of the probe.

Automotives - hardness testing
The Rockwell hardness testing equipment for crankshafts is a device designed particularly for this application purpose using a Rockwell measuring head of the company ERNST
The following specifications are fulfilled by the hardness testing equipment:
-
Standard hardness testings in the Rockwell procedure perpendicularly at all taps of crankshafts with reciprocal centering borehole to overall length 800mm and maximum flight circle diameter 250mm.
-
By use of a particularly made penetrator with 5mm width and an accordingly narrow support the distance can be tested from 3mm of the crank . The penetrator and the support are extended and reach a depth of approx. 80mm.
